I remember the 'Dog Food' analogy of the 1960s. The dog food company had a big pipeline, into which they fed the basic ingredients for their staple dog food. Downstream of that, they introduced some other ingredients for their mid-market product. The final addition, downstream yet again, introduced some minor ingredients for their premium product.

They made a sizeable profit on the staple product, a larger percentage profit on the mid product and a huge profit on the premium product.

You will all end up working for the same pedigree company, but they will retain the brand names to pretend there is a difference and maximise profits.
